Here are a few things you should know:
  • This site is mobile friendly. You do not need a log-in or password to access information.
  • Jobs on this site are original and unduplicated and come from three sources: the Federal government, state workforce agency job banks, and corporate career websites. All jobs are vetted to ensure there are no scams, training schemes, or phishing.
  • The site is refreshed daily to remove out-of-date content.
  • The newest jobs are listed first, so use the search features to match your interests. You can look for jobs in a specific geographical location, by title or keyword, or you can use the military crosswalk. You may want to do something different from your military career, but you undoubtedly have skills from that occupation that match to a civilian job.

Maintenance Technician

Pay based on relevant feed mill or production facility experience.

6:00a-4:00p Mon-Fri, Overtime as needed, on call every other week including overnights and weekends.

Are you an experienced Maintenance Technician looking for a new opportunity? Do you enjoy working on various facilities and equipment? If so, this position is for you!! A local feed manufacturing facility in Sheldon, IA is searching for a Maintenance Technician to join their growing team! As a Maintenance Technician, you will be directly responsible for maintaining and servicing all plant equipment and buildings.

Responsibilities:

  • Develop a maintenance plan timeline with includes all facility equipment, instructions, and tasks.

  • Establish and conduct regularly scheduled inspections of all equipment items IAW maintenance plan.

  • Troubleshoot and repair mechanical problems in the plant.

  • Ensure adequate supply of food grade lubricants, equipment parts and tools in stock.

  • Organize and maintain operator’s manuals, files, and parts lists for all equipment.

  • Maintain accurate and complete records of work performed and manpower time distribution.

  • Other duties as assigned.

Requirements:

  • Adequate formal training or experience as a millwright and/or welder.

  • Strong knowledge of feed mill operations. Extensive working knowledge of shop, power/hand tools, and maintenance equipment.

  • Ability to recognize and troubleshoot electrical problems.

  • Knowledge of OSHA safety requirements, FSMA, and Feed & Food Safety Plan.

  • Good communication, verbal, written and math skills.

  • Thorough understanding of cGMP’s
